Why Reporting Accidents Matters



If you experience a mishap at the office, reporting it right away is vital. Pennsylvania law calls for prompt notice to your employer, which can make a big distinction in safeguarding benefits and safeguarding your rights. Even if an injury appears minor, some conditions get worse with time. Trigger reporting guarantees proper documents, which is crucial if you need to sue or look for further clinical treatment.



Companies in Philadelphia must follow stringent standards for office safety and accident coverage. When staff members speak out, it aids develop safer work environments for everyone. Don't let problems about revenge stop you from making your mishap recognized-- numerous employees are protected under state and federal regulation.



What to Do After a Workplace Accident



Taking the proper steps after a crash can affect both your healing and your lawful civil liberties. Always seek clinical focus, even if you think the injury is minor. Doctor in Philadelphia know with workplace injuries and can offer the treatment and documents required for your claim.



Notify your supervisor or company asap. In Pennsylvania, waiting also long can influence your ability to access workers' payment benefits. Paper every little thing, from the moment and area of the crash to the names of any kind of witnesses. If your injury arised from malfunctioning equipment or unsafe conditions, preserving proof is crucial for your case.

Local Factors Affecting Workplace Safety



Philadelphia's climate and framework develop unique difficulties for employees. Abrupt snow storms can leave walkways and parking lots icy and dangerous. Summer thunderstorms commonly bring about power failures, impacting everything from elevators in high-rise buildings to safety lighting on building sites. Older homes and companies, much of which still utilize out-of-date electrical wiring or lack modern safety features, can increase the threat of fires, electric shocks, and various other mishaps.



Even the city's public transportation contributes. Employees who commute by subway, bus, or cart encounter direct exposure to crowded problems, unsafe platforms, and unexpected solution interruptions. These elements underscore the relevance of staying alert and ready, regardless of your industry.
